Structure of the Intellect

SOI stands for Structure of the Intellect which is the name given to a theory of intelligence developed by the American Psychologist J.P. Guilford. In this theory intelligence is seen as a complex system of interrelated intellectual (cognitive) functions or abilties.

Theory of Multiple Intelligences

The structure of intellect model is not hierarchical in nature. Instead it classifies intellectual abilities into a cross-classification of the abilities. As the cube below illustrates. One way of classification is in terms of the mental OPERATION involved in the abilities. Each ability involves simply:

  • cognition (knowing)
  • memory
  • divergent productions (generation)
  • convergent productions
  • evaluation (judging goodness of what is known or produced)
